In times of emergency, effective communication is vital in ensuring that people are kept safe and informed. emergency voice communication systems play a crucial role in providing clear and reliable communication during critical situations.
emergency voice communication systems, also known as emergency intercom systems, are used in various settings such as tall buildings, public spaces, schools, hospitals, and industrial facilities. These systems allow for two-way communication between individuals in distress and first responders or security personnel. They are designed to provide instant access to help in case of emergencies such as fires, medical emergencies, and security breaches.
One of the key benefits of emergency voice communication systems is their ability to provide real-time information during emergencies. In situations where time is of the essence, having a direct line of communication with emergency services can greatly improve response times and ultimately save lives. By allowing individuals to quickly alert authorities of an emergency, emergency voice communication systems help prevent further escalation of the situation and facilitate a rapid and coordinated response.
Another important feature of emergency voice communication systems is their ability to broadcast clear and concise instructions to people in the affected area. In cases of fires or other emergencies where evacuation is necessary, these systems can be used to provide guidance on evacuation routes, assembly points, and safety procedures. By ensuring that everyone receives the same information at the same time, emergency voice communication systems help avoid confusion and panic, and facilitate a smooth and orderly evacuation process.
emergency voice communication systems are also essential for improving the safety and security of buildings and facilities. By allowing security personnel to monitor and respond to incidents in real-time, these systems help prevent unauthorized access, theft, vandalism, and other security threats. In addition, the presence of emergency voice communication systems can act as a deterrent to potential wrongdoers, as they know that help is just a button press away.
In recent years, advancements in technology have greatly enhanced the capabilities of emergency voice communication systems. Modern systems are now equipped with features such as integrated cameras, motion sensors, and automated alerts, which help improve situational awareness and enable faster and more effective responses to emergencies. Some systems also incorporate voice recognition software, allowing individuals to communicate with the system hands-free, which can be particularly useful in situations where they are unable to use their hands.
Moreover, emergency voice communication systems are often integrated with other emergency notification systems, such as fire alarms, emergency lighting, and mass notification systems. This integration allows for a coordinated and comprehensive response to emergencies, ensuring that all aspects of emergency preparedness and response are seamlessly integrated and synchronized.
